Chao Song is a scholar working on Health, Toxicology and Mutagenesis, General Health Professions and Economics and Econometrics. According to data from OpenAlex, Chao Song has authored 46 papers receiving a total of 704 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Health, Toxicology and Mutagenesis, 8 papers in General Health Professions and 8 papers in Economics and Econometrics. Recurrent topics in Chao Song's work include Global Health Care Issues (7 papers), Health disparities and outcomes (6 papers) and Viral Infections and Immunology Research (6 papers). Chao Song is often cited by papers focused on Global Health Care Issues (7 papers), Health disparities and outcomes (6 papers) and Viral Infections and Immunology Research (6 papers). Chao Song collaborates with scholars based in China, United States and United Kingdom. Chao Song's co-authors include Jinfeng Wang, Jintao Yang, Yanchen Bo, Yang Yang, Fei Guo, Lei Xie, Xiaowen Li, Xun Shi, Adrian Chong and Ngoc-Tri Ngo and has published in prestigious journals such as The Science of The Total Environment, Journal of Cleaner Production and Scientific Reports.
